An electronic power transformer (EPT) with supercapacitors storage energy system is proposed in this paper. The proposed system consists of an EPT, a supercapacitor bank and a bidirectional dc–dc converter. The supercapacitor bank is connected to the dc link in EPT through the dc–dc converter. An ac/dc hybrid parallel operation control scheme of EPT based on distributed logic control is proposed in order to eliminate circulation current and further improve redundancy performance in this paper. The proposed ac/dc hybrid parallel operation control scheme consists of a dc side current-sharing control scheme and an ac side current-sharing control scheme.
